Ordered a 2013 M3!

I have finally broken down after a year and a half of toying with the idea of getting an M3, and ordered one last weekend. It was completely spontaneous, absolutely not my style but it was alot of fun completing the order.

Heres the order:
2013 M3 Coupe
Color- "pending"
Black leather
ZCP
ZPP
DCT
Enhanced Audio
Heated Seat

Personally the only reason I ordered Comp package is because of the wheels. Not going to track it, so I guess the package will suffice for what it is. The enhanced premium audio is some of the best I have heard.

Cannot wait to recieve build date, vin date, etc as I have with my other cars.

Oh- first mod will be : Eisenmann Race Exhaust. Its melody is so sweet to the ears!
